Short Film-Storyboard

Circular shot of dice on the floor to display the key theme of the film.
Boy looks at the dice in his hand and slowly rolls it around showing the numbers 1-6.
Tilt shot down to boy-We see a car driving past in the distance.
This distracts him and he quickly stands up ready to go after it.
With a roll of the dice, this decides whether he should follow the car or not.
Tracking/Stationary shots of the boy walking toward the driveway.

Short clips front and behind to display movement.
Panning shot of the car pulling into the driveway and parking.
Extreme close up of the wheel as it comes to a steady stop.
After the boy steals the car, include many extreme close ups and long shots displaying the environment. 
Boy gets out the car and walks over a wooden bridge (Over Camera)
Boy shows the dice away after receiving multiple numbers of bad luck.
Smooth transition between the boy and a new character walking in from out of frame.
Final shots of the boy coming across the dice and walking toward the camera, as the movie fades to black.
